About Blue Mountain, Ontario

Blue Mountain is a locality in Peterborough, Ontario, Canada. It is classified as a small locality. Blue Mountain is located at 44.6748°N, 77.9450°W.

Blue Mountain rises as a stoic presence amidst the rugged, ancient terrain of the Canadian Shield. It lies 44.2 km south of Bancroft, ON (from Bancroft, ON: bearing 188°T), and is situated 14.3 km south-east of Apsley.
